In the winter of 1947, the reckless and joyous Dean Moriarty, fresh out of another stint in jail and newly married, comes to New York City and meets Sal Paradise, a young writer with an intellectual group of friends, among them the poet Carlo Marx. WebViolence is one of the primary themes in The Road. It’s everywhere that The Man and The Boy travel. It’s something they avoid and, unfortunately, something they’re forced to use to defend themselves. For example, when The Man kills the Roadrat who attempts to kidnap, and likely kill and eat, The Boy. He shoots him in the head, using one ...

The man is the boy's father. He believes it is his duty to keep his child safe from the new world; even if it means shooting him before highwaymen can harm and tortue him. The man has a deep connection with his son because that is the only thing he has in the post-apocalyptic world.
